Eco-Friendly Car Insurance: Save Money and Protect the Planet in 2025



The intersection of environmental responsibility and financial savings has created an exciting new category in the auto insurance industry: eco-friendly car insurance.

In 2025, as climate awareness grows and sustainable practices become mainstream, insurance companies are introducing policies that reward eco-conscious drivers. From electric vehicle coverage to discounts for fuel efficiency and green driving habits, eco-friendly car insurance offers a win-win solution—protecting your car while reducing your carbon footprint.


Understanding Eco-Friendly Car Insurance

Also known as green car insurance, these policies are tailored for:

  • Drivers of electric vehicles (EVs), hybrids, and alternative-fuel cars

  • Motorists who practice sustainable driving habits

  • Customers seeking to align personal values with insurance choices

Unlike traditional auto insurance, which looks only at risk and repair costs, eco-friendly coverage considers:

  • Environmental impact

  • Fuel efficiency

  • Carbon reduction practices


Types of Green Vehicle Coverage

Electric Vehicle (EV) Insurance

EV-specific coverage may include:

  • Battery replacement protection against costly failures.

  • Charging equipment coverage for home charging stations.

  • Mobile charging roadside assistance.

  • Certified EV repair networks.

Hybrid Vehicle Policies

For hybrid drivers, insurers often offer:

  • Fuel efficiency discounts linked to MPG ratings.

  • Low mileage incentives for reduced emissions.

  • Eco-certified repair options.

  • Carbon offset programs built into premiums.

Alternative Fuel Vehicle Coverage

For vehicles powered by biodiesel, CNG, or hydrogen:

  • Fuel system protection for specialized components.

  • Conversion equipment coverage.

  • Specialized liability coverage for alternative fuel risks.


Cost-Saving Benefits and Discounts

Eco-friendly car insurance provides several ways to cut costs:

Premium Reductions

  • 5–15% discounts for green or hybrid vehicles.

  • Additional savings for low-emission ratings.

  • Rewards for sustainable driving practices.

Usage-Based Insurance Programs

Using telematics and mobile apps, insurers now measure:

  • Miles driven (pay-per-mile programs).

  • Eco-driving scores (smooth acceleration/braking).

  • Efficient route planning.

  • Public transport usage credits.

Multi-Policy Environmental Discounts

Bundled savings may include:

  • Discounts for homes with solar panels.

  • Combined green auto + home insurance packages.

  • Add-ons like bicycle insurance.

  • Rewards for carbon offset participation.

FAQs About Eco-Friendly Car Insurance

1. Do all EV or hybrid drivers qualify for green insurance?

Yes, most eco-friendly policies are designed for EVs, hybrids, and alternative fuel vehicles, though eligibility varies by provider.

2. Can green insurance be cheaper than regular auto insurance?

Yes. With discounts, usage-based tracking, and bundling, premiums are often 10–30% lower.

3. Does eco-friendly insurance cover battery replacement?

Many EV policies include battery replacement protection, though coverage limits vary.

4. What happens if I exceed mileage caps?

Exceeding limits may reduce discounts or shift you into a higher premium tier. Some insurers offer flexible mileage adjustments.

5. Do insurers really invest in green infrastructure?

Yes, many allocate funds to carbon offsets, EV charging networks, and renewable projects.

6. Is eco-friendly car insurance available in all states?

Most states have insurers offering green options, but discounts and programs differ regionally.
